** The Audi repair market in and around Hartford, Vermont, is characterized by a reliance on high-quality independent specialists rather than a high volume of dedicated Audi dealers or shops. Hartford itself, being a smaller town, does not have a standalone Audi dealership, which pushes demand toward the surrounding hubs of White River Junction, VT, and Hanover/Lebanon, NH. The competition level is moderate but specialized; while there are many general auto repair shops, only a handful possess the specific tooling, software, and certified expertise for complex Audi systems like Quattro and DSG transmissions. The average quality of these top-tier specialists is very high, often exceeding dealership service in personalized care while maintaining technical proficiency. Typical pricing reflects this expertise, with labor rates generally ranging from $140 to $180 per hour, which is standard for premium European automotive service in the Northeast. Given Hartford's cold winters and road salt use, common local Audi issues include premature brake corrosion, suspension wear from potholes, and electrical problems related to moisture. Quattro all-wheel-drive system maintenance is also crucial for handling Vermont's variable road conditions.

Labor rates in the Hartford area may be slightly lower than in major metropolitan areas, but the cost for genuine Audi parts and specialized labor remains significant. The primary advantage is supporting a trusted local business that understands the wear from local driving conditions.
For complex warranty work or major recalls, the nearest dealerships in New Hampshire may be necessary. However, for most routine maintenance, repairs, and diagnostics, a qualified independent shop in the Hartford area can provide personalized, often more cost-effective service without the long drive.
The Vermont climate demands vigilant attention to undercarriage washing to combat rust from road salt and more frequent inspections of cooling and heating systems. Using a local shop familiar with preparing Audis for harsh New England winters can prevent costly seasonal damage.
